Colorado College
Colorado Springs, Colorado

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Colorado College. It ranked #1 on our 2023 Best Value Regional Studies (U.S., Canadian, Foreign Schools in the Rocky Mountains Region list. This small school is located in Colorado Springs, Colorado, and it awarded 1 ’s regional studies (U.S., Canadian, foreign) degrees in 2020-2021.

As a testament to the quality of education offered at Colorado College, the school also landed the #1 spot in our “Best Regional Studies (U.S., Canadian, Foreign) Schools in the Rocky Mountains Region” ranking. It costs about $24,703 for rocky mountains region regional studies (u.s., canadian, foreign students per year to attend Colorado College.

The undergraduate student-to-faculty ratio of 9 to 1 is a sign that students will have more opportunities to engage with their professors one-on-one. The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 86%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year. The undergrad student loan default rate at the school is 0.5%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.
